ultra low power jan 15

21
Ultra low power

Upload: marshal-raj

Post on 19-Dec-2015

7 views

Category:

Documents


0 download

DESCRIPTION

low power techniques

TRANSCRIPT

Page 1: Ultra Low Power Jan 15

Ultra low power

Page 2: Ultra Low Power Jan 15

Low power hand

04/18/23 ULTRA LOW POWER TECHNIQUES 2

Page 3: Ultra Low Power Jan 15

Ultra low power techniques

• Subthreshold operation• Encoding• Parallel processing• Balance computation and communication • Reduce the amount of information to be processed• Operate slowly and adiabatically• feed forward information reduction• Dynamic Voltage and Frequency Scaling (DVFS)• Dynamic Power Switching (DPS)

04/18/23 ULTRA LOW POWER TECHNIQUES 3

Page 4: Ultra Low Power Jan 15

Subthreshold operation

Advantages:• The gm/I ratio is maximum such that speed per watt or precision per watt is

maximized.• for a given VDD, the on–off current ratio is maximized in this regime.• enable VDD minimization• velocity saturation effects and thermal noise are nonexistent in the Subthreshold

regime and improve energy efficiency in the analog and digital domains.• resistive and inductive drops due to parasitic that can degrade gm are minimized

Disadvantages:• highly sensitive to transistor mismatch, power-supply noise, and temperature.• Linearization is more difficult

04/18/23 ULTRA LOW POWER TECHNIQUES 4

Page 5: Ultra Low Power Jan 15

ULP techniques…

• Encoding• Efficient encoding minimizes switching and leakage power

• Parallel processing• High speed, low power but area increased

• Balance computation and communication (data compression)• Less computation, more transmission• More compuatation, less transmission

• Reduce the amount of information to be processed• Using AGC circuits/ learning circuits to accumulate knowledge • Needs knowledge of algorithms, signal processing, architecture, circuit topology,

device physics

04/18/23 ULTRA LOW POWER TECHNIQUES 5

Page 6: Ultra Low Power Jan 15

ULP techniques…

• Operate slowly• Operate five times below fT

• Minimizes the voltage drop• Minimizes power dissipation

• Adiabatic switching• Reuse the signal energy• When voltage between drain and source exists, don’t on or off the transistor• The transistor must not be turned off when there is a significant current

flowing between its source and drain

04/18/23 ULTRA LOW POWER TECHNIQUES 6

Page 7: Ultra Low Power Jan 15

ULP techniques…

• feed forward information reduction• Clock gating• Wake up circuits

• Dynamic Voltage and Frequency Scaling (DVFS)• Dynamic Power Switching (DPS)

04/18/23 ULTRA LOW POWER TECHNIQUES 7

Page 8: Ultra Low Power Jan 15

REVERSIBLE LOGIC

04/18/23 REVERSIBLE LOGIC 8

Page 9: Ultra Low Power Jan 15

Gates

• Feynman gate• Toffoli gate• Fredkin gate• Double Feynman Gate (F2G) • Peres Gate • TSG gate • Sayem gate

REVERSIBLE LOGIC 904/18/23

Page 10: Ultra Low Power Jan 15

Feynman gate (controlled NOT gate)

04/18/23 REVERSIBLE LOGIC 10

Page 11: Ultra Low Power Jan 15

Toffoli gate (controlled-controlled NOT gate)

04/18/23 REVERSIBLE LOGIC 11

Page 12: Ultra Low Power Jan 15

Fredkin gate (Controlled swap gate)

04/18/23 REVERSIBLE LOGIC 12

Page 13: Ultra Low Power Jan 15

Double Feynman Gate (F2G)

04/18/23 REVERSIBLE LOGIC 13

Page 14: Ultra Low Power Jan 15

Peres Gate

04/18/23 REVERSIBLE LOGIC 14

Page 15: Ultra Low Power Jan 15

TSG gate

04/18/23 REVERSIBLE LOGIC 15

Page 16: Ultra Low Power Jan 15

Sayem gate

04/18/23 REVERSIBLE LOGIC 16

Page 17: Ultra Low Power Jan 15

REVERSIBLE BASIS

04/18/23 REVERSIBLE LOGIC 17

Page 18: Ultra Low Power Jan 15

REVERSIBLE SIMULATION OF CLASSICAL GATES

04/18/23 REVERSIBLE LOGIC 18

Page 19: Ultra Low Power Jan 15

Using Fredkin gate

04/18/23 REVERSIBLE LOGIC 19

Page 20: Ultra Low Power Jan 15

• Garbage bit• Non constant output line that is not part of the desired result

• Ancilla bit• Bit assured to be constant at both input and output

04/18/23 REVERSIBLE LOGIC 20

Page 21: Ultra Low Power Jan 15

References

• Universal Principles for Ultra Low Power and Energy Efficient Design by Rahul Sarpeshkar, Senior Member, IEEE, TCAS II Vol 59, no.4,April 2012• Design of Reversible logic circuits using standard cells-standard cells and

functional programming by Michael Kirkedal Thomsen, ISSN: 0107-8283• Introduction to Reversible Logic Gates & its Application by Sujatha.S.Chiwande,

NCICT 2011

04/18/23 ULTRA LOW POWER TECHNIQUES & REVERSIBLE LOGIC 21